FAQS on 乾燥ナツメ茶のレシピ

Q: How do I make traditional dried red date tea at home?

A: Simmer 10-15 dried red dates in 4 cups of water for 20-30 minutes. Strain and serve warm, optionally adding honey or ginger for extra flavor. This recipe enhances digestion and boosts energy.

Q: What are the health benefits of Chinese herbal red date tea?

A: Rich in iron and antioxidants, it supports blood health, reduces stress, and strengthens immunity. Its natural sweetness makes it a popular herbal remedy in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M).

Q: Can I mix dried red date tea with other herbs?

A: Yes! Pair it with goji berries, astragalus, or chrysanthemum for added benefits. These combinations align with TCM principles to balance Qi or address specific health concerns.

Q: How should I store dried red dates for tea?

A: Keep them in an airtight container in a cool, dark place to prevent moisture and pests. Properly stored, they retain potency for up to 1 year.

Q: Is dried red date tea safe for daily consumption?

A: Generally yes, but limit to 1-2 cups daily. Consult a TCM practitioner if pregnant, on medication, or with chronic conditions to avoid interactions.
